The ADR3430 is low-cost, low-power, high precision voltage references, featuring ± 0.1% initial accuracy, low operating current and low output noise in a small SOT23 package. For high accuracy, output voltage and temperature coefficient are trimmed digitally during final assembly using Analog Devices’ proprietary Digi-Trim® technology.
Stability and reliability are further improved by the devices’ low output voltage hysteresis and low long-term output voltage drift.
Furthermore, the low operating current of the device (100 μA max) facilitates usage in low-power devices, while its low output noise helps maintain signal integrity in critical signal processing systems.
These CMOS are available in a wide range of output voltages, all of which are specified over the industrial temperature range of −40°C to +125 °C.
